Accor plans Colombia's third Sofitel

Accor Group’s Sofitel Hotels & Resorts brand is set to open its third property in Colombia. The Sofitel Calablanca will open by 2021 in Barú, joining the Sofitel Bogotá Victoria Regia and Sofitel Legend Santa Clara.
 
Accor has began the construction of the property in alliance with Patrimonios Estrategias Inmobiliarias, Cementos Argos and Arquitectura y Concreto. The partners are in the process of registering for certification in sustainable construction under the LEED system to improve efficiency in terms of energy, construction processes and environmental-impact management. The architectural design is expected to “achieve a balance between the natural ecosystems and the exclusive surrounding community,” according to the company.
 
Sofitel Calablanca will have space for 400 guests on a campus of more than 19,750 square meters.
 
Expected to open in mid-2021, Sofitel Calablanca will consist of a main building (housing the lobby, restaurants, spa, fitness center and kids’ club) and a total of 187 rooms, including 23 suites,  distributed across 10 smaller buildings all with ocean views and balconies. Public spaces will include three restaurants, six bars, more than 1,000 square meters of meeting rooms and four swimming pools.
